Output 5dc5147966abcdb0f71a3589e11589f7e0bad01cfdb4d898541ea54b901644f2:1

value
999985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f2e89859e8642f164b077bcedd64cc8737f44e OP_EQUAL
address
39oLP1So5NhP4vRjKS7rzh1Kvmop8DQghv
transaction
5dc5147966abcdb0f71a3589e11589f7e0bad01cfdb4d898541ea54b901644f2
spent
true